Overview
We are seeking a highly skilled and compassionate Paramedic to provide advanced medical care and support to patients in their homes. The role supports GP practices in undertaking home visits, aims to reduce hospital admissions, and improve patient outcomes by delivering timely and effective healthcare services in a home setting.
Responsibilities
* In liaison with the practice GP deliver high quality, responsive healthcare services to patients in their homes, including assessments, diagnostics, treatment, and follow-up care.
* Work collaboratively with GPs, nurses, and social care providers to ensure comprehensive patient care.
* Interview patients, take medical histories, perform physical examinations, analyse and diagnose, and explain medical problems during surgery consultations and home visits.
* Recommend and explain appropriate diagnostic tests and treatment.
* Perform specialised diagnostic physical exams and treatment procedures.
* Instruct and educate patients in preventative health care.
* Order laboratory tests as required and agreed under supervising doctor(s).
* Fully document all aspects of patient care and complete all required paperwork for legal and administrative purposes.
* Formulate diagnoses and treatment plans in consultation with or referring to supervising doctor(s) as appropriate.
* Educate patients and their families on health conditions, treatment plans, and preventive measures to promote self-management and long-term wellbeing.
* Ensure medical equipment is maintained, clean, and in good working order.
